Steps to Successful Savings

A person usually asks questions: “How to learn to save money or to how to save money?”, when it already lacks them. A need or desire arises that cannot be immediately satisfied due to lack of funds, and after this comes the decision to accumulate money.

  • The first step to successful fundraising is knowing your purpose. What do you need money for and how much exactly will you need?

Sometimes a citizen decides to simply save money in reserve, people say "for a rainy day." This is a goal, but not a specific one. It is easier to save up a certain amount for a purchase, a trip, a vacation, treatment, study, and so on, since such a goal is specific, which is why the will will be stronger.

If there is a temptation to spend money on something unplanned, the image of a desired object (for example, a renovated apartment) is more likely to help refrain from wasting than an ephemeral “for later”. In addition, people usually do not know how much money they will need in reserve, while the price of a planned purchase or event is known in advance.

  • Second step. How to save money? This will help analyze the costs over time. What is the money usually spent on?

The main items of expenditure are:

  1. food;
  2. clothing and footwear;
  3. household chemicals, household goods;
  4. mandatory payments (utilities, Internet, telephone, transport, loans, etc.);
  5. spending on entertainment and recreation;
  6. Unexpected expenses.
  • You need to master bookkeeping. For a month, write down every day in a table, where each column is an expense item, and a line is a calendar day, how much and what exactly was spent.
  • At the end of the month, summarize: what is the most money spent on, what is the percentage for each expense item, and, most importantly, you need to find those expenses that were clearly unnecessary, as well as what you can save on.
  • Accounting and control of money can be kept in a special computer program for home accounting. On the Internet, you can find many similar programs and choose the most convenient one, for example, Toshl Finance.
  • This step is very important, because before you start saving money, you need to understand how to spend money the right way.

The percentage ratio between income and expense items varies for each person, and therefore the monthly amount for accumulation will be different. But the most suitable amount to start saving money is considered to be ten percent of income.

The following formula shows how to derive this percentage:

100% - 50% - 20% - 15% - 5% = 10%

100% income minus 50% food and mandatory fees, minus 20% clothing and household items, minus 15% entertainment, minus 5% contingencies = 10% savings.

If in a month it turned out to spend a smaller amount of money than planned, then it is added to the deferred ten percent, and not wasted. For example, over the past month, it was not necessary to purchase clothes or shoes - there is additional profit.

An important rule of accumulation: do not save on entertainment! It is impossible to rest either actively or passively without spending some money. If you completely abandon entertainment, the accumulation of money will be perceived as a serious necessity that worsens the quality of life. Accordingly, the probability of a breakdown will be greater, disappointment will come, you will want to give up on your cherished goal.

  • Third step. How to save money and accumulate the right amount of them? You can't do without financial discipline. Costs need to be controlled and manage money properly.

If a decision has been made to set aside ten percent of income, this must be done. To how to save money the right way? You can buy or make a piggy bank for money, or you can take it and put it in a bank account.

Unfortunately, it is difficult to be one hundred percent sure of the safety of money in the bank, but still, if they lie there, there is practically no temptation and opportunity to take them at any moment to spend on an unplanned purchase. In addition, the deposit involves the payment by the bank to its client of interest on the invested amount, that is, in addition to savings, you can get passive income.

If you urgently need to save

If, after analyzing your budget and determining the amount that you can save monthly, a person understands that it will be possible to accumulate the required amount of money only after ten years, and there is no way to wait that long, the question is: “How to learn how to save money?” remains virtually unanswered. Therefore, it is necessary to understand the right way to save.

If there is a time frame that determines the moment when the required amount must be collected, the algorithm of actions changes:

  1. The period in which you need to accumulate the n-th amount of money, divided into months. Divide the required amount of money by the number of months and get the amount that needs to be set aside once a month.
  2. Considering the amount that can be set aside without damage, determine the items of expenditure that still need to be reduced in order to accumulate money in a short time. In other words, find what you can save on and how to save money. You may have to give up a lot, but if the goal is desired, you can endure a little.
  3. If you can’t find that item / items of expenses that can be “cut”, then you need to either increase your income (look for a side job, passive income, change jobs, etc.) or postpone the deadline for achieving the goal.

Making a to-do list

It's best to plan tomorrow's schedule on the evening of the previous day, so you still have fresh memories of today's work, about what remained unfinished. The most important rule is to set realistic and specific goals (see ""). The task of “starting a new life” is not specific and not real, but “do exercises” and “take a contrast shower in the morning” are already quite feasible.

Do not try to cram everything into your schedule at once, because there are only 24 hours in a day. It is better to do 2-3 things well than to plan 15-20 and not do a single one.

After compiling a to-do list, prioritize, that is, those tasks that are of the greatest importance, highlight in a different color or underline.

If you think you are a strong person who can immediately get into work, schedule all the important things for the morning. If you are a supporter of the theory of biorhythms and you need to “swing”, leave simple activities in the morning that will set you up for work.

Once your plan is ready, take a look at it "from the outside" - are there things in it that have already lost their relevance or will not contribute to your success? If there are such cases, feel free to cross them out, do not try to reschedule for another day. These unpromising tasks are holding you back.

Now about time. For each task, write down the time you are going to spend on it. These precious minutes should be calculated as accurately as possible so that tomorrow everything goes according to plan, and the deadlines are not missed. Try to realistically assess the amount of work ahead.

To avoid missed deadlines, schedule some extra time. To do this, conditionally divide the working day into two halves and indicate a reserve block between them. So, if you have an urgent problem in the morning, and the time according to the plan shifts, you compensate for this loss with a reserve. You can also leave 15 spare minutes in each hour for the same purpose.

During the first time of work on a schedule, you will use the reserve, but then it will remain, and here another question arises - what will you spend it on? For entertainment or self-education? Of course, the second option is preferable, but it all depends on how you are used to spending your free time.

What is procrastination?

"Put off until tomorrow what you can do today." It is the tendency to delay or evade the task to be done. Instead, we focus on other tasks that are less important and more enjoyable.

For example, you should start preparing for exams, but instead you start browsing the news in VKontakte. Only 5 minutes. And later you suddenly find that 3 hours have passed. Or an even more ridiculous example. When you prefer to wash all the dishes in the house, as well as at the neighbors' houses, than to take up your studies.

Why are we doing this? Why do some people procrastinate more than others? Why do we sabotagethemselves?

Find out what goes on in the mind of a procrastinator in the following video. How does their brain function? Is it different from other people's brains? Activate subtitles!

Why do we procrastinate? What is going on in our brain?

We find it hard to put off pleasure

The tasks we usually put off tend to be boring or unfulfilling and unproductive for a long time. People, like animals, tend to primarily perform those tasks that bring visible results in a short period of time. From the point of view of evolution, we inherited a tendency to impulsiveness and momentary satisfaction from distant ancestors. In those days, people preferred to eat well. today, because the prospects for tomorrow were highly questionable.

It seems that today this behavior model does not work. The future is no longer so uncertain. We began to feel more confident about the future, and over time we learned self-control. Our brains have evolved to learn how to delay pleasure. However, for us, getting an immediate benefit is still more tempting than expecting a better, but far-off result. The fact is that the ability to delay this benefit is not an easy task. Thus, children spend enough time to overcome impulsivity, learn to control themselves and see that sometimes it is better to put aside immediate gratification and focus on long-term gain. However, there are some who never succeed.

Impulsivity is closely related to procrastination. This is a personality trait that is based on a systematic tendency to seek immediate gain without thinking about the consequences. If we are impulsive and allow ourselves to be distracted by those activities that give us instant gratification, we will be more prone to procrastination.

Impulsivity and procrastination are highly hereditary traits, according to this study. In addition, according to the researchers, both of these traits are combined together, and procrastination is becoming a modern manifestation of the impulsiveness that was characteristic of our ancestors.

The Marshmallow Test: A Test for Delayed Pleasure

In the next video, you can find out what the essence of the Marshmallow Test is, or, as it is also called, the Marshmallow Test. This study shows how children responded to delayed gratification. Four-year-old kids were given a cloud of marshmallows, or marshmallows, and warned that they could eat it, but if they were patient and waited only 15 minutes, they would receive a second such marshmallow as a reward. What do you think the children did?

15 years later, the researchers analyzed how the fate of these children developed, and came to a surprising conclusion. Most of those who managed to resist the temptation became more successful, went to university and had better academic performance than those who could not resist and ate a marshmallow cloud.

Task characteristics

According to a study conducted at the University of Konstanz in Germany, there is a higher chance of procrastination when we see the task at hand in too abstract a way. Conversely, if we focus on the details, concretizing for ourselves how, when, and where the task has to be completed, the probability of its “postponement” will be significantly lower.

The complexity of the task also plays an important role. as a cause of procrastination. The more difficult a task seems to us, or the less equipped we feel for it, the more likely we are to put it off until later. Motivation and commitment performance also determines our propensity to procrastinate.

Anxiety and stress

Do anxiety and stress affect procrastination? Sometimes we have so many things to do that we don't know where to start. Anxiety sometimes paralyzes us so much that we fail to do anything we planned.

Procrastination reduces stress

The behavior of a procrastinator has a functional basis. Knowing that we have to do something, a project, a job or something else, we begin to experience some anxiety (great or minor, depending on the person and the characteristics of the task). If we put this task aside and do something else that is more enjoyable, we can reduce our stress levels. But at the same time, the habit of procrastinator behavior will gain additional strength and create a model for learning and repetition in the future.

When you think again about the task that you should have done, it will cause you the already familiar anxiety, and the whole cycle will begin anew. Therefore, it takes so much work to get rid of this type of behavior.

How to avoid procrastination?

1. Make lists of tasks you need to complete

List only those tasks that you usually put off doing. Do not include similar tasks that require the same resources from you. And don't set too many goals for yourself. Be realistic. If you schedule more tasks than you can handle, then you risk losing motivation when you realize you haven't done it. It's better to schedule a few tasks and get them all done than to make a long list and panic about it and end up doing nothing at all.

2. Divide the task into several parts

If the task is complex, break it down into easier parts. This will help you flesh it out and see it as more achievable. Plan how you will do it, when and where. In addition, going through these small milestones will increase your motivation.

3. Prioritize

Not all tasks are equally important. Prioritize to make sure you do the most important things first.

4. Avoid multitasking

Multitasking does not contribute to our efficiency if we want to achieve a good result. Concentrate as much as possible on one thing, and then your attention will not be distracted. Moreover, this one will help you control your stress and anxiety levels.

5. Eliminate distractions

If you're one of those people who tend to procrastinate because you get distracted easily, it's best to eliminate all distractions. Mute your mobile and deactivate all phone or computer notifications. If you have social networks bookmarked in your internet browser, hide them in folders to make them less accessible.

6. Business time, fun hour

This is what my mother always told us in childhood, and she was absolutely right. Avoid everyone's favorite approach: "I'll quickly look at the news in Vkontakte, and immediately get to work." Take care of the main task first, and when you are done, you can afford rest and entertainment.

7. Visualize goals

Having a clear idea of ​​what benefits the completed task will bring to you will give you a positive boost of motivation. Alternatively, think about the consequences of delaying a task, such as failing to meet a deadline, performing poorly or mediocrely, disappointing someone...

8. Ask for help

If you think the task is too difficult, feel free to ask for help.

9. Take control of your stress and anxiety levels

If a task, or several tasks that you have to complete, causes you anxiety and paralyzes you, the first thing to do is to relax. Learn more about how to manage your anxiety levels according to the progressive relaxation method. You can also try mindful meditation method, which allows not only to cope with stress, but also helps to improve attention and concentration.

10. Tell others about your plans

If you tell other people about the task that you have to perform, you will begin to realize a higher degree of responsibility for the result. Feeling ashamed before a public defeat can be a great motivator.

11. It's never the right moment.

Don't leave for tomorrow what you can do today. Do you put something off until later just because there is no right moment for it? Imagine that if you still haven't found that moment, maybe it doesn't exist at all. If you wait for the right moment to come, you will never get it done.
